In a world where myths seem real, Shadow And Tide follows a strong girl whose journey through love, loyalty, and destiny will impact readers everywhere. As magic whispers rise like the tide, she has to deal with dangers from outside and problems within, wondering who she can trust and what she is ready to give up. Rachel Greenlaw creates a universe where water and night are not just things, but forces that change lives, destiny, and relationships. This builds tension that keeps readers turning page after page.

Information About the Product
ISBN-13: 9780008211837
Rachel Greenlaw is the author
HarperCollins is the publisher
Language: English
Binding Type: Paperback;
Number of Pages: 368;
Publication Date: February 2024; Genre: Fantasy, Contemporary Fiction
